[City Hall pic] Construction on the City Hall was begun in 1898 after the old structure was destroyed by fire.
If you go inside the main entrance, you will find an engraved plaque on the right hand wall; the plaque was initially commissioned at the inception of the building, but there was a problem with the text.
The assistant architect was J.W Siddall, and the inscription reads:

"ASS ARCHITECT"

and the stonemason never received any financial incentive to correct the error--

so here it remains for all to see.
